The map title is Saint John. Tactile map scale. 2 centimetres = 3 kilometres North arrow pointing to the north. Saint John and surrounding area. The Bay of Fundy is shown with a wavy symbol to indicate water. Main roads, routes. 1, 7, 111. A ferry route that goes to Digby, Nova Scotia, is indicated with a dash line. A circle with a dot in the middle to indicate a bus station is located in the southeast of the city. A circle with the shape of an airplane indicates an airport located east of the city. Tactile maps are designed with Braille, large text, and raised features for visually impaired and low vision users. The Tactile Maps of Canada collection includes: (a) Maps for Education: tactile maps showing the general geography of Canada, including the Tactile Atlas of Canada (maps of the provinces and territories showing political boundaries, lakes, rivers and major cities), and the Thematic Tactile Atlas of Canada (maps showing climatic regions, relief, forest types, physiographic regions, rock types, soil types, and vegetation).
